Pursuant to the provisions of Title 17, Chapter 9, Section 5 of the Code of Alabama (1975), notice is hereby given that Special Elections, to fill the Alabama State House Districts 55 and 16 vacancies, will be held at designated District 55 and District 16 polling locations on Tuesday, September 26, 2023. If necessary, a Runoff Elections will be held October 24, 2023. The Polls will be open from 7:00 a.m. until 7:00 p.m. on those dates.

 

Pursuant to the provisions of § 21-4-23, Code of Alabama (1975), notice is hereby given that:

 

  1. Instructions, printed in large type, will be conspicuously displayed at each voter registration site and polling place, sufficient to provide hearing impaired and seriously visually impaired individuals with adequate information as to how and where they may register and vote.

 

  1. Each polling place shall have an Express Voter Assist Terminal for use by individuals with disabilities who would otherwise be prevented from voting because of their inability to mark a paper ballot.

 

  1. Absentee ballots are available to any handicapped or elderly individual who, because of disability or age, is unable to go to their assigned polling place to vote on election day. The deadlines for requesting and submitting an absentee ballot are the same as for other persons seeking to vote by absentee ballot.

 

  1. Any handicapped or elderly individual who, because of handicap or age, requires assistance in casting a vote, may select a person of his or her choice to accompany such individual into the polling place to assist in the casting of the vote.

 

Further, § 17-9-13(a), Code of Alabama (1975) states, “Any person who wishes assistance in voting may receive assistance from any persons the voter chooses except the voter’s employer, an agent of the employer, or an office or agent of the voter’s union.”
